Might be too late, but...
I was also stuck in Bialystok, Poland ( I am cycling and was headed east to Belarus & the Baltic States, but the borders closed on me on Saturday ). Time to backtrack and head back home but all international trains, buses stopped running almost immediately. Almost all flights out of Poland were also cancelled. You are still able to leave the country though, that's what I just did ( yesterday ). Get to Szczecin on the German border by train. Then hitch a ride on the highway to Berlin just west of town. It is still open. All other options/roads are sealed off. It is mostly trucks on the road because of the restrictions for regular folks. There are still no controls/restrictions to get into Germany yet but it might change soon. Hope that helps. |
